What online white card training in South Australia really involves

In South Australia, you can finish the country wide acknowledged system CPCCWHS1001, Prepare to function safely in the building and construction market, via a real-time online session with an approved registered training organisation. As opposed to a pre-recorded e-learning component, the instructor runs a virtual classroom, validates your ID, and examines your understanding and practical skills on cam. This is the layout made use of by most white card training Adelaide on-line programs.

image

Expect a mix of short concept sectors, discussion, danger recognition jobs utilizing pictures or situations, and a useful component where you demonstrate correct use of personal protective equipment and secure actions to usual construction website risks. The instructor must be able to assess that you can interact, comply with directions, and use the content in context, not just click via slides.

Because it is live and interactive, the technical needs are modest however non-negotiable. If the stream drops every 5 mins, or your microphone removes, analysis can not proceed. Basic as that.

Webcam and sound that your assessor can trust

Trainers are educated to observe. They need to see your face clearly, see just how you fit PPE, and detect whether you comprehend instructions. A 720p web cam suffices if it is stable and well lit. Do not overthink resolution. Rather, focus on angle and light.

Raise the camera to eye degree. A pile of publications under a laptop computer works. Prevent placing bright home windows straight behind you, which transforms your face into a shape. A desk lamp targeted at the wall surface in front of you offers even, soft light and prevents harsh shadows.

For audio, the most basic trusted alternative is wired earbuds with an in-line microphone. They reduced area echo and maintain your hands complimentary. Bluetooth functions, yet batteries fall short at awkward minutes, and some conference applications deal with Bluetooth switching badly. If you have to use the laptop computer microphone, rest closer to the display and prevent tapping the desk.

Internet that holds up under pressure

Most white card program Adelaide sessions are 2 to 4 hours. You do not require ultra fast speeds, yet you do need consistency. A stable 5 to 10 Mbps down and 1.5 to 3 Mbps up is great for a solitary HD video stream with sound, screensharing, and periodic data uploads.

If your Wi Fi is irregular:

    Sit near the router or plug in with Ethernet if your laptop computer has the port or a USB adapter. Ask others at home to pause streaming throughout your session. Have a mobile hotspot ready as a contingency, and examination it when so you understand the password and signal stamina in your study spot.

Regional South Australia presents its own challenges. If you reside on a residential or commercial property with variable function, scout your best signal place the day before. A simple 4G signal booster or a directional antenna on a window can make the distinction between choppy sound and a clear call.

The software side that slips up on people

Most white card training Adelaide providers make use of traditional platforms like Zoom, Microsoft Teams, or a protected in web browser service. Whichever it is, the grab is normally approvals, not the application itself.

Update your browser to the current variation of Chrome, Edge, or Safari. Enable video camera and microphone gain access to in both the internet browser and your os settings. Switch off aggressive appear blockers for the session tab, as they can hinder file submits or identification check tools.

If your workplace laptop is locked down, firewall program regulations might obstruct web cam access or downloads. Use a personal tool or speak with your IT admin early. Public networks at libraries or cafes can be loud and uncertain, and numerous will certainly block peer to peer connections used by conferencing tools. For a white card adelaide online evaluation, that is a risk you do not need.

Have a PDF viewers mounted for training course materials or statements you may need to authorize. Keep your phone nearby as a scanner using its camera, in instance the trainer requests a fast picture of your ID or an authorized declaration.

The papers instructors should see

A trainer can not provide you a white card if they can not validate who you are. Expect to existing original picture ID on electronic camera and, in many cases, publish a clear photograph or check. A present chauffeur's permit, a key, or an evidence old card are the typical alternatives. If your name has actually transformed or your ID does not match your enrolment, bring sustaining documentation.

You will additionally require an One-of-a-kind Trainee Identifier, CPCCWHS1001 online Adelaide the USI. It is totally free to create in a couple of mins, yet you do need your ID handy. Without a USI, an RTO can not release your statement of accomplishment that underpins your white card. If you are reserving an exact same day course, sort your USI the night prior to. It is the solitary most typical delay I see with white card training Adelaide students.

The PPE inquiry, responded to sensibly

The useful component of a white card training course is not complex, yet it is hands on. You may be asked to determine when each product of PPE is required, fit it properly, check for damage, and describe its limitations. In a classroom, trainers maintain a tub of gear for individuals. Online, you need at least the essentials handy or a plan with your provider.

The most common set includes a construction hat, high presence vest or tee shirt, shatterproof glass, and general purpose job gloves. Hearing defense, like earplugs or earmuffs, is usually discussed and in some cases demonstrated. Steel cap boots are useful to possess, however not always needed for the online demonstration if you can describe where they are necessary.

If you are new to construction and do not yet own PPE, ask your RTO whether they can send by mail out a kit, car loan one in your area, or approve demo utilizing obtained products. Abilities Educating College, as an example, can recommend on appropriate alternatives and what the assessor requires to see clearly on electronic camera. In my experience, a crisp demonstration beats a pricey brand name. A fundamental, intact construction hat fits the bill if you adjust the harness and show the clearance. Safety glasses should wrap the sides of the eyes. High vis requires to be really visible.

How real-time assessment plays out on camera

White card adelaide training supplied online has a rhythm. The instructor verifies your ID and USI. They established ground rules for concerns and breaks. You may finish a short composed part in an online type, then move into hazard identification. Expect practical situations: identifying unguarded sides, acknowledging exemption zones, recognizing wrong ladder angles, or keeping in mind missing barricades.

PPE presentation usually follows. The assessor will ask you to reveal the condition of your gear, fit it, and clarify when you would put on each item. They will certainly look for fundamental proficiency, not excellence. If your shatterproof glass haze, claim how you would certainly resolve it. If your gloves are loose, show how you would select a better pair. What issues is a secure, educated approach.

The trainer's lens is usefulness. They want to see you can request for aid when you hit the restrictions of your capability. They intend to listen to that you would report dangers as opposed to winging it. Clear communication and situational understanding count.

Common challenges, and how to avoid them

The most regular technical issue I see is unpredictable upload rate. Download and install could look fine, however if your upload dips, your video stutters and your audio drops. The easiest solution is to halt other upstream tasks. Cloud image backups and game updates are the wrongdoers. If that stops working, a mobile hotspot with decent 4G often fixes it.

Another trap is dissimilar names between your enrolment, your USI, and your ID. If your booking says Sam Smith but your ID is Samantha Jones after a name modification, flag it early. The admin team can note it and request sustaining records instead of halting the assessment.

Using a phone without a stand rates high on the disappointment listing. A phone moving down a stack of cushions mid assessment hinders emphasis. A low-cost tabletop tripod or even a mug propping the phone at the ideal angle makes an exceptional difference.

Background helpers are a genuine problem. A member of the family whispering suggestions violates evaluation regulations and undermines your outcome. You will be asked to reveal your space is clear completely reason. Establish expectations with housemates ahead of time.

After the session: what takes place next

If you are examined as experienced, the RTO documents your result and issues your declaration of accomplishment. The physical white card is after that generated and sent by mail to the address you provided. Turn-around for the card depends on handling and message, commonly a few service days to a couple of weeks. If you need proof earlier, request for an interim certificate or letter. Numerous sites accept this while you await the card, yet always verify with the primary contractor.

Keep your card safe and your information current. If you relocate or alter names, inform your supplier or the issuing body so substitute cards can locate you.
